Our tooth chart, featuring the international numbering system for teeth, shows the standard tooth numbering system from 1 to 32, upper & lower. A teeth chart is a simple drawing or illustration of your teeth with names, numbers, and types of teeth. A tooth numbering chart is a system used to record information about specific teeth. This is a dental practitioner view, so tooth number 1, the rear upper tooth on the patient's right, appears on the left of the chart.
